What AI Is and How It Works

At its core, Artificial Intelligence is a field of technology that enables computers to perform tasks that typically require human intelligence. These tasks range from understanding language and recognizing images to predicting trends and making recommendations. AI systems are designed to analyze data, identify patterns, and make decisions based on those patterns.

AI is built on the principle of “learning from data.” Think about how we learn as people—over time, we observe, analyze patterns, and make conclusions. AI follows a similar process, but it does so with vast quantities of data and at a much faster pace. It’s like a virtual assistant that doesn’t just follow set rules but actually gets “smarter” by learning from experience.

Most AI tools are powered by algorithms, which are essentially step-by-step instructions for solving a problem or analyzing information. These algorithms allow AI to process data and spot patterns. For example, if you upload hundreds of photos of a specific item (say, different kinds of plants), an AI tool can analyze and classify the plants based on their features. It doesn’t understand plants as we do, but it has learned patterns about plant types from the data. This pattern recognition is what gives AI its power—it can analyze information, learn from it, and improve its accuracy over time.

Why AI Matters for Independent Professionals

AI offers tools that can significantly boost productivity, allowing independent professionals to work smarter, not harder. Here are some specific benefits:

1. Smarter Decision-Making
AI excels at analyzing information, which can give you insights that might otherwise take hours of research to uncover. For instance, if you work in marketing, an AI tool can analyze social media trends and customer behavior to help you understand what content resonates most with your audience. This quick access to insights enables you to make informed decisions that improve your strategy.

2. Saving Time by Automating Tasks
AI tools can handle repetitive tasks that don’t need your direct attention, giving you more time to focus on creative or strategic work. For instance, instead of manually sorting emails or scheduling client appointments, you could use AI-powered tools to automate these processes. By automating repetitive work, you can save hours each week—time that could be redirected toward business development, skill-building, or simply enjoying personal time.

Additionally, this automation gives you the freedom to use your saved time however you please. Whether it’s catching up on a hobby, spending more time with family, or exploring new professional opportunities, the time saved through AI’s efficiency provides flexibility that every independent professional values.

3. Enhancing Productivity and Workflow
AI can help streamline your workflow. By analyzing your habits and preferences, it can suggest ways to make your process more efficient. For example, project management AI tools can track your progress and give reminders, helping you stay on track without needing to monitor every detail manually. AI’s insights and automated support can make it easier to manage your workload, allowing you to stay organized and productive with less effort.

Real-World Examples of AI in Action for Professionals

To understand the true value of AI, it’s helpful to look at some straightforward, real-world applications. Here’s how AI is already helping independent professionals in different industries:

Client Communication: AI chatbots can handle frequently asked questions or initial client inquiries. For example, if you’re a consultant or coach, an AI chatbot can manage client inquiries on your website, answering basic questions about services or pricing. This way, you’re only directly involved with leads who are ready for the next step. Clients receive instant responses, and you’re free to focus on high-value interactions.

Data Management and Analysis: For independent professionals working in fields like finance, real estate, or marketing, managing data is often a major task. AI can analyze patterns within your data, helping you make informed recommendations faster. Imagine you’re a freelance analyst—AI tools can scan through sales data, highlighting trends that show which products or services are performing best. With these insights, you can advise clients more accurately, boosting your value and impact without spending extra hours crunching numbers.

Automating Repetitive Tasks: AI can simplify routine tasks that take up time, such as invoicing, follow-up emails, or even sorting through research articles. For instance, if you’re a freelance graphic designer, an AI tool could automate initial design concepts based on client preferences. This doesn’t replace your work but gives you a head start, letting you focus on refining designs rather than starting from scratch. By setting AI to handle repetitive tasks, you free yourself up to work on more complex, rewarding aspects of your projects.

Content Creation: Many independent professionals, such as writers, bloggers, and social media managers, use AI tools to help brainstorm, organize, or even draft content ideas. For a freelance writer, AI can suggest trending topics based on industry keywords or generate content outlines, reducing the time spent on initial planning. By leveraging these tools, you can produce higher-quality content more quickly, enhancing both your output and client satisfaction.

These examples show that AI can improve productivity and enhance client experiences without requiring extensive technical knowledge on your part.

How to Start Adopting AI as an Independent Professional

Starting with AI doesn’t have to be overwhelming. Here are some practical steps for integrating AI into your work without the technical complexity:

1. Identify Pain Points in Your Workflow


Begin by identifying areas in your work where you spend a lot of time or repeat similar tasks. These areas are prime candidates for AI support. For example, if you find yourself spending hours sorting emails, look for an AI tool that can categorize or prioritize your inbox based on relevance.

2. Start Small with Accessible Tools


There are many AI tools that offer free or trial versions. Start with tools that provide simple, specific functions, such as scheduling apps, grammar checkers, or project management assistants. Experimenting with accessible tools gives you a feel for how AI can integrate into your work without requiring a big commitment.
